## 1. Deep Dive into Licensed Landscape Architecture
Landscape architecture is more than just gardening or planting trees. It’s a sophisticated profession that blends art, science, and environmental stewardship to create functional, aesthetically pleasing, and sustainable outdoor spaces. A **licensed landscape architect** is a highly trained and qualified professional who has met rigorous standards of education, experience, and examination to ensure they are competent to practice landscape architecture.
### Comprehensive Definition, Scope, & Nuances
At its core, landscape architecture involves the planning, design, and management of outdoor environments. This includes everything from parks and gardens to streetscapes, plazas, and residential landscapes. The profession considers the ecological, social, and aesthetic aspects of the land to create spaces that are both beautiful and functional. A **licensed landscape architect** understands the complex interplay of these factors and uses their expertise to create designs that are environmentally responsible, socially equitable, and economically viable.
The history of landscape architecture dates back centuries, with early examples found in ancient Egypt and Rome. Over time, the profession has evolved to incorporate new technologies, materials, and design philosophies. Today, landscape architects are at the forefront of addressing critical issues such as climate change, urbanization, and resource management. They play a vital role in creating sustainable communities and enhancing the quality of life for people around the world.
### Core Concepts & Advanced Principles
Several core concepts underpin the practice of landscape architecture, including:
* **Site Analysis:** Thoroughly assessing the existing conditions of a site, including its topography, soils, vegetation, hydrology, and climate.
* **Design Principles:** Applying principles of design, such as balance, unity, rhythm, and proportion, to create visually appealing and harmonious spaces.
* **Sustainability:** Integrating sustainable practices into all aspects of the design, including water conservation, energy efficiency, and the use of native plants.
* **Accessibility:** Ensuring that outdoor spaces are accessible to people of all abilities, in compliance with the Americans with Disabilities Act (ADA) and other regulations.
* **Construction Detailing:** Developing detailed construction drawings and specifications to guide the implementation of the design.
Advanced principles in landscape architecture include:
* **Ecological Design:** Creating landscapes that mimic natural ecosystems and support biodiversity.
* **Stormwater Management:** Designing systems to manage stormwater runoff and reduce flooding.
* **Urban Design:** Planning and designing the physical environment of cities, including streets, parks, and public spaces.
* **Land Reclamation:** Restoring degraded or contaminated land to a productive and healthy state.

### Expert Explanation
Landscape Architecture Design Services involve the complete process of transforming an outdoor space from concept to reality. This includes initial site analysis, conceptual design, detailed design development, construction documentation, and construction administration. A **licensed landscape architect** applies their expert knowledge of plants, materials, grading, drainage, and construction techniques to create designs that meet the client’s needs and goals.
What sets Landscape Architecture Design Services apart is the holistic approach taken by licensed professionals. They consider not only the aesthetic aspects of the landscape but also its environmental impact, functionality, and long-term sustainability. They integrate principles of ecological design, stormwater management, and accessibility to create spaces that are both beautiful and responsible.
## 3. Detailed Features Analysis of Landscape Architecture Design Services
Landscape Architecture Design Services offer a multitude of features, each contributing to the creation of exceptional outdoor spaces. Here are seven key features:
### Feature 1: Site Analysis and Assessment
* **What it is:** A thorough examination of the existing site conditions, including topography, soil types, vegetation, drainage patterns, climate, and existing infrastructure.
* **How it works:** The **licensed landscape architect** conducts on-site surveys, collects data, and analyzes the information to identify opportunities and constraints for the design.
* **User Benefit:** Provides a solid foundation for the design process, ensuring that the design is responsive to the site’s unique characteristics and challenges.
* **Demonstrates Quality:** Shows a commitment to understanding the site and creating a design that is appropriate for its context.
### Feature 2: Conceptual Design
* **What it is:** The development of preliminary design concepts that explore different spatial arrangements, circulation patterns, and aesthetic themes.
* **How it works:** The **licensed landscape architect** creates sketches, diagrams, and renderings to communicate the design ideas to the client.
* **User Benefit:** Allows the client to visualize the potential of the site and provide feedback on the design direction.
* **Demonstrates Quality:** Showcases the landscape architect’s creativity and ability to generate innovative design solutions.
### Feature 3: Detailed Design Development
* **What it is:** The refinement of the conceptual design into a detailed plan that specifies materials, dimensions, and construction methods.
* **How it works:** The **licensed landscape architect** prepares detailed drawings and specifications that can be used by contractors to build the design.
* **User Benefit:** Provides a clear and comprehensive set of instructions for the construction process, minimizing the risk of errors and delays.
* **Demonstrates Quality:** Reflects the landscape architect’s attention to detail and technical expertise.
### Feature 4: Planting Design
* **What it is:** The selection and placement of plants to create visually appealing, ecologically sound, and sustainable landscapes.
* **How it works:** The **licensed landscape architect** considers factors such as plant hardiness, soil conditions, sunlight exposure, and water requirements to choose the right plants for the site.
* **User Benefit:** Enhances the beauty of the landscape, provides shade and shelter, and supports biodiversity.
* **Demonstrates Quality:** Showcases the landscape architect’s knowledge of plants and their ability to create thriving ecosystems.
### Feature 5: Hardscape Design
* **What it is:** The design of non-plant elements in the landscape, such as patios, walkways, walls, and water features.
* **How it works:** The **licensed landscape architect** selects materials, specifies dimensions, and details construction methods to create durable and aesthetically pleasing hardscape elements.
* **User Benefit:** Creates functional and attractive outdoor spaces for recreation, relaxation, and entertainment.
* **Demonstrates Quality:** Reflects the landscape architect’s understanding of construction techniques and materials.
### Feature 6: Irrigation Design
* **What it is:** The design of efficient and effective irrigation systems to provide water to plants.
* **How it works:** The **licensed landscape architect** calculates water requirements, selects appropriate irrigation equipment, and designs a system that minimizes water waste.
* **User Benefit:** Ensures that plants receive adequate water, promoting their health and growth while conserving water resources.
* **Demonstrates Quality:** Shows a commitment to sustainability and responsible water management.
### Feature 7: Construction Administration
* **What it is:** The oversight of the construction process to ensure that the design is implemented correctly and according to the plans and specifications.
* **How it works:** The **licensed landscape architect** visits the site regularly, reviews shop drawings, and answers questions from the contractor.
* **User Benefit:** Provides quality control and ensures that the project is completed to the highest standards.
* **Demonstrates Quality:** Reflects the landscape architect’s commitment to delivering a successful project.

**Q1: What is the difference between a landscape architect and a landscaper?**
**A:** A landscaper typically focuses on the installation and maintenance of landscapes, such as mowing lawns, planting flowers, and pruning shrubs. A **licensed landscape architect**, on the other hand, is a trained professional who designs outdoor spaces, considering factors such as site analysis, design principles, sustainability, and construction techniques. Landscape architects are often involved in larger-scale projects, such as parks, plazas, and commercial developments.
**Q2: Why is it important to hire a licensed landscape architect?**
**A:** Hiring a **licensed landscape architect** ensures that you are working with a qualified professional who has met rigorous standards of education, experience, and examination. Licensing protects the public by ensuring that landscape architects have the necessary knowledge and skills to design safe, functional, and sustainable outdoor spaces.
**Q3: What types of projects do landscape architects typically work on?**
**A:** Landscape architects work on a wide range of projects, including residential landscapes, parks, plazas, streetscapes, commercial developments, and environmental restoration projects.
**Q4: How much does it cost to hire a landscape architect?**
**A:** The cost of hiring a **licensed landscape architect** varies depending on the scope and complexity of the project. Landscape architects typically charge an hourly rate or a percentage of the total construction cost.
**Q5: How do I find a qualified landscape architect?**
**A:** You can find a qualified **licensed landscape architect** by contacting the American Society of Landscape Architects (ASLA) or your state’s licensing board. You can also ask for referrals from friends, family, or colleagues.
**Q6: What questions should I ask a landscape architect before hiring them?**
**A:** Before hiring a landscape architect, you should ask about their experience, qualifications, design philosophy, fees, and references.
**Q7: What is the role of a landscape architect during the construction process?**
**A:** During the construction process, the **licensed landscape architect** oversees the implementation of the design, ensuring that it is built according to the plans and specifications. They may also answer questions from the contractor and make adjustments to the design as needed.
**Q8: How can I ensure that my landscape design is sustainable?**
**A:** You can ensure that your landscape design is sustainable by working with a **licensed landscape architect** who is knowledgeable about sustainable design practices. They can incorporate features such as native plants, efficient irrigation systems, and permeable paving materials.
**Q9: What are the benefits of using native plants in my landscape design?**
**A:** Native plants are adapted to the local climate and soil conditions, requiring less water, fertilizer, and pesticides than non-native plants. They also provide food and habitat for birds, butterflies, and other wildlife.
